Why Scalable Cryogenic Technology Is the Missing Link in Space Infrastructure (and How EXOS + Scorpius Are Solving It)
The space economy is growing fast—really fast. Analysts are projecting trillions of dollars in growth as satellites, space tourism, manufacturing, and even research facilities head off-planet. But there’s one big bottleneck no one talks about at cocktail parties: cryogenic propellant storage and transport.
In plain English? Without scalable, reliable cryogenic tank technology, spaceflight stays expensive and risky. That means slowed innovation and lost opportunities.
That’s exactly why EXOS Aerospace acquired Scorpius Space Launch Company. Scorpius brings decades of experience designing and delivering advanced composite cryogenic tanks—proven tech with real flight heritage. Pair that with EXOS’s reusable rocket platforms, and you’ve got a powerful combination designed to do one thing: make access to space faster, cheaper, and more sustainable.
